What is SEPA Instant?
The Single Euro Payments Area (SEPA) Instant is a European initiative that allows instant fund transfers between payment processors and financial institutions. Unlike traditional bank transfers, which can take 1-3 business days, SEPA Instant enables near-instant crypto-to-fiat settlements and significantly reduces liquidity risks for crypto payment processors.

Challenges in Implementing Crypto Processors with SEPA Instant
Despite the advantages, payment processors face challenges in integrating crypto processors with SEPA Instant:
-
Regulatory Uncertainty: The European Union is still defining compliance requirements for crypto processors and digital assets.
-
Technical Integration: Implementing security-enhanced memory access, a double encryption device, and hardware layers for seamless crypto-to-fiat transactions can be complex.
-
Merchant Adoption: While more merchants accept cryptocurrency payments, widespread adoption requires educational initiatives and regulatory support.
Best Practices for Implementing Crypto Processors
Implementing crypto processors requires careful consideration of several factors to ensure that they are used effectively and securely. Here are some best practices to follow:
-
Proper Configuration and Integration: Ensure that the crypto processor is properly configured and integrated into the system. This involves setting up the hardware and software components correctly to maximize security and efficiency.
-
Physical Security Measures: Implement physical security measures to protect the crypto processor from tampering or unauthorized access. This includes securing the physical location of the hardware and using tamper-evident seals.
-
Secure Communication Protocols: Use secure protocols for communication with the crypto processor. This ensures that data transmitted to and from the processor is encrypted and protected from interception.
-
Regular Updates and Patching: Regularly update and patch the crypto processor to ensure that it remains secure. Keeping the firmware and software up to date helps protect against new vulnerabilities and threats.
-
Secure Key Management: Implement secure key management practices to protect sensitive data. This includes generating, storing, and managing cryptographic keys in a secure manner to prevent unauthorized access.
By following these best practices, businesses can ensure that their crypto processors are used effectively and securely, providing robust protection for sensitive data and transactions.
